How they compare

Guatemala currently reports 246,229 kg against 152,071 kg in Afghanistan, a difference of 94,158 kg.

That makes Guatemala's figure about 1.6 times Afghanistan's.

Across all 63 years both countries report, Guatemala has been ahead every year.

Afghanistan ranks 24th and Guatemala ranks 21st of 81 countries.

Guatemala has averaged higher in every one of the 7 decades both report.

The Livestock Manure domain of FAOSTAT contains estimates of nitrogen (N) inputs to agricultural soils from livestock manure. Data on the N losses to air and water are also disseminated. These estimates are compiled using official FAOSTAT statistics of animal stocks and by applying the internationally approved Guidelines of the Intergovernmental Panel on Climate Change (IPCC). Data are available by country, with global coverage and updated annually.The following elements are disseminated: 1) Stocks; 2) Amount excreted in manure (N content); 3) Manure left on pasture (N content); 4) Manure left on pasture that volatilises (N content); 5) Manure left on pasture that leaches (N content); 6) Manure treated (N content); 7) Losses from manure treated (N content); 8) Manure applied to soils (N content); 9) Manure applied to soils that volatilises (N content); 10) Manure applied to soils that leaches (N content).
